Wall Street was pointing toward gains in premarket trading Wednesday as markets focus on the latest corporate earnings ahead of the Federal Reserve's interest rate decision this afternoon.
Futures for the S&P 500 were up 0.3% before the opening bell, while futures for the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 0.2%. Nasdaq futures were 0.5% higher. A day earlier, all three indexes set all-time highs for a third straight session.
